Manchester man sentenced to prison for strangulation

MANCHESTER, N.H.- Authorities say Aaron Plourde has been sentenced to 3½ to 7 years in prison following his conviction on multiple felony and misdemeanor charges, including strangulation and witness tampering,

According to court documents on September 21, 2025, Plourde went to the victim’s residence and a verbal argument quickly escalated into a violent physical attack that, including attempting to strangle the victim.

A jury convicted Plourde of; two counts of Second-Degree Assault – Strangulation, two counts of Solicitation to Commit Witness Tampering and Five misdemeanor charges
